I was working at a NW Companion Pet Fair today in the delta/pet partners booth with Silas, and on the way out I saw folks there from the Himalayan chew company. My dogs love these things, so I went to see if they were doing any special pricing.
I learned a trick that I had never heard and wanted to share! You know how the dogs get to the end and you have to take away the nub so they don't swallow a large piece? Well it turns out that if you throw the chunk in the microwave for 40 seconds or so, it puffs up and softens, and when it cools you can give it to the dogs. I'm definitely going to try it - always seems like such a waste...
